#413 of 469 2011 XC60 R-Design by idmd

Sep 24, 2011 (3:44 am)

Just purchased a new (had 4 miles on it sitting in showroom) 2011 R-Design 3.0T with Multimedia, Climate, BLIS and Metallic paint for $44975 including destination plus $375 documentation fee and tax, title, reg. Compared to the 2012's it has the added benefit of +10K on the maintenance plan plus they weren't giving nearly as good a deal. In 5 years the value difference between 2011 and 2012 will be minimal.
 
MSRP was $48100. Thought it was a good deal.

#418 of 469 2011 XC60 T6 AWD by rohan_b79

Oct 05, 2011 (9:29 am)

Just got my new 2011 XC60 T6 AWD in San francisco, with PREMIER PLUS + CLIMATE pkg W/ HEATED REAR SEATS + XENON + PCC + NAVI PREP .
 
MSRP- $44020
Invoice- $41651
Final Purchase Price- $41000
 
What do you guys think, did I pay a little too much or is that fine or a super deal? Let me know your thoughts.
 
Thinking of getting the Volvo Sensus navigation installed, has anyone done that, if so please share cost and user experience.
The dealer said that there were only 3-4 of these in the whole of the western US. Being a 2011 it has the extra 10K miles on the maintenance compared to the 2012's.
